How Does Material Choice Impact the Durability of Carryons?
Material choice significantly impacts the durability of carry-ons. Different materials offer varying levels of strength, flexibility, and resistance to wear. Common materials include polycarbonate, nylon, and aluminum.
Polycarbonate is lightweight and highly durable. It withstands impacts well and resists cracking. This material provides excellent protection for belongings inside the carry-on.
Nylon is another popular choice. It is flexible and resistant to tearing. Nylon can also repel water, keeping contents dry. However, it may show wear over time, especially in high-friction areas.
Aluminum is known for its strength. It offers a premium feel and can protect against heavy impacts. However, it is heavier than other materials. Aluminum carry-ons may also dent upon impact but will maintain structural integrity.
The thickness of the material also affects durability. Thicker materials often provide better protection against damage but may increase weight. Manufacturers often balance thickness with weight when designing carry-ons.
Zippers and handles are also crucial. Durable zippers made from quality materials ensure longevity. Reinforced handles can prevent breakage during travel.
Overall, selecting the right material enhances a carry-on’s durability. Consumers should consider their travel habits and choose materials that best meet their needs.
Why Does the Weight of a Carryon Matter for Travel?
The weight of a carry-on matters for travel because airlines impose strict weight limits to ensure safety and efficiency. Exceeding these limits can lead to additional fees or the need to check the bag, which adds inconvenience.
According to the International Air Transport Association (IATA), each airline has specific policies governing the maximum weight for carry-on luggage. These policies are designed to maintain balance on the aircraft and prevent injury to passengers and crew.
The primary reasons behind baggage weight limitations include aircraft safety, space management, and passenger convenience. Heavier carry-ons can impact the aircraft’s balance. If too many heavy bags are stored in one area, it can affect how the plane handles. Additionally, managing space on board is crucial. Aircraft cabins have limited overhead compartment space, and heavier bags can lead to difficulties in storing them efficiently.
Technical terms related to this issue include “maximum weight allowance” and “passenger load.” The maximum weight allowance specifies the heaviest a carry-on bag can be without incurring fees. Passenger load refers to the total weight of passengers and their luggage, affecting the aircraft’s overall performance.
Airlines measure the weight of carry-on bags at the check-in counter or the boarding gate. A bag that exceeds the recommended weight may need to be checked in. For example, if an airline allows a maximum weight of 7 kg, and a passenger’s bag weighs 10 kg, the passenger must either remove items or check the bag, which could delay boarding.
Understanding these factors can help travelers pack efficiently and comply with airline regulations, ensuring a smoother travel experience.

What Carryons Offer Maximum Durability for Frequent Flyers?
The carry-ons that offer maximum durability for frequent flyers are typically made from high-quality materials and feature robust design elements.
- Hard-shell carry-ons
- Soft-shell carry-ons
- Carry-ons with reinforced corners
- Carry-ons with high-quality zippers
- Carry-ons made from ballistic nylon
- Lightweight carry-ons
- Water-resistant carry-ons
- Warranty and replacement policies
Durability in carry-ons is critical for frequent flyers. Understanding the different types of durable carry-ons helps travelers make informed choices.
-
Hard-shell carry-ons: Hard-shell carry-ons feature a rigid exterior made from materials like polycarbonate or ABS plastic. These materials provide excellent protection for items inside the luggage. According to a 2021 review by Travel + Leisure, hard-shell luggage typically withstands rough handling more effectively than soft-shell alternatives.
-
Soft-shell carry-ons: Soft-shell carry-ons are often made from durable fabrics, such as nylon or polyester. The flexibility of these materials can make them lighter and easier to pack. However, they may not offer the same level of protection as hard-shell carry-ons.
A study published in the Journal of Travel Research in 2020 found that while hard-shells are preferable for fragile items, soft-shells can better accommodate odd-shaped belongings. -
Carry-ons with reinforced corners: Carry-ons that feature reinforced corners are less likely to suffer damage during transit. The corners experience the most stress during handling. This design is crucial for frequent flyers who often check their bags.
-
Carry-ons with high-quality zippers: High-quality zippers made from sturdy materials reduce the risk of malfunction. Cheap zippers can break easily, leading to security concerns and lost belongings. A comparison by Gear Patrol in 2023 highlighted that brands offering YKK zippers consistently rank higher for durability.
-
Carry-ons made from ballistic nylon: Ballistic nylon is a thick, durable fabric originally developed for military use. It resists abrasions and tears, making it a popular choice for long-lasting luggage. Brands like Tumi and Briggs & Riley often use this material in their luxury carry-ons.
-
Lightweight carry-ons: While weight is a consideration, lightweight carry-ons often balance durability and ease of transport. Frequent flyers prefer lightweight options to avoid airline weight limits. A survey by Consumer Reports in 2022 indicated travelers frequently choose brands emphasizing lightweight designs without sacrificing durability.
-
Water-resistant carry-ons: Water-resistant materials help protect belongings from moisture. Frequent flyers who encounter varying weather conditions benefit from this feature. The American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M) defines water resistance in fabrics, ensuring quality standards are met.
-
Warranty and replacement policies: Purchasing carry-ons with strong warranties provides confidence in the durability of the luggage. Many high-quality brands offer lifetime warranties, emphasizing their commitment to durability. Claims from Luggage Count, a luggage review site, show that such warranties often indicate manufacturers’ belief in their products’ resilience.
